The paper describes recent V-22 Integrated Test Team/NAVAIR full-scale downwash survey activity conducted as part of the V-22 Uncommanded Roll On-Deck test program. The objectives of the surveys were to quantify the aerodynamic disturbances driving the V-22’s on-deck uncommanded roll response experienced during recovery operations of upwind rotorcraft. Over 300 wake survey events were conducted aboard LHA and LHD class ships between October 2002 and November 2003, using an array of ultrasonic anemometers designed to measure the variation in wake induced velocities across the span of the V-22’s rotors. Data were recorded as various rotorcraft flew constant height and mission representative approaches, upwind hovers, departures, and air taxis past the array. Aircraft surveyed include the UH-1N, CH-46, and the CH-53E platforms. In addition to the anemometer data, the trajectory of the approaching aircraft was recorded using an IR tracking/laser ranging system. Ship motion and wind-over-deck data were also acquired, completing a comprehensive dataset.
